How hard is Neumann University to get into?

This page provides the latest information on Neumann University (Neumann)'s admission process, acceptance rate, and student profile. Neumann's acceptance rate is 81.28% for 2024-2025 admission. A total of 4,215 students applied and 3,426 were admitted to the school. Its acceptance rate is relatively high, making it somewhat easy to get into Neumann.

Admission Statistics

For the academic year 2024-25, Neumann's acceptance rate is 81.28% and the yield (also known as enrollment rate) is 10.19%. 1,521 men and 2,694 women applied to Neumann and 1,160 men and 2,266 women students were accepted.

Among them, 121 men and 228 women were enrolled in Neumann. You can explore the Neumann's admission rates and SAT score trends over the past decade, including year-by-year data and analysis, by visiting Admission Trends page.

Application Requirements

It requires to submit High School GPA and English Proficiency Test to its applicants.

The SAT and ACT test score is not considered in admission process at Neumann. The english proficiency test is required .
